Pacelli boys take third in Hayfield Invite
Sep. 4—The Pacelli boys finished in third place at the 13-team Hayfield cross country invite Thursday.
The Shamrocks were led by Zemecha McManus who took third, and Isaac Johnson took sixth.
The GMLOS girls took fourth place as Naomi Warmka finished in 11th and the BP girls took fifth place, with Haley McIntosh taking ninth.
